- the present invention relates to a medical aspirator fixing device, in particular in the medical aspirator for forcibly aspirating and discharging discharge discharged to the surgical site of the patient or the airways of the critical patient using a low vacuum pressure, to prevent the flow or movement of the tube member
- the present invention relates to a medical aspirator fixing device capable of preventing departure of the medical aspirator.
- a medical aspirator (medical low pressure sustained aspirator) is forcibly aspirating discharged discharged to the surgical site of the patient or the airways of the intensive care patient using a low vacuum pressure.
- FIG. 1 is a view showing a hemo-vac, a negative pressure drainage device used as a conventional medical aspirator.
- the drainage container 10 is bound to one side of the tube 11 and the middle thereof.
- the stopper 12 is provided in the part.
- one side of the drain container 10 is equipped with a fixed hook 13 is configured to hang the drain container 10 in a suitable position, such as a bed, trocar (Trocar) on the other side of the tube (11) 14) is mounted.
- a suitable position such as a bed
- trocar Trocar
- the tube 11 is sealed with the skin and the seal so that the tube 11 does not fall out of the affected part and then the contracted drainage container ( Due to the force of 10) the secretion, such as blood or body fluids accumulated in the affected part can be collected and stored in the drainage container 10 through the tube (11).
- Such a medical aspirator is used to inhale secretions, such as blood or body fluid, by using the suction force generated by the expansion of the plastic drainage container while retaining the end of the tube in the affected part of the patient.
- Secretions such as blood or body fluids extracted through the medical aspirator, serve as a medium for the medical staff to check the prognosis of the surgical site of the patient in real time through a sampling test.
- the medical aspirator does not simply stay in the auxiliary means for aspirating and discharging the discharge of the patient, but various applications such as abdominal fat removal surgery performed by plastic surgery, low pressure continuous aspirator, and aspiration aspirator It is becoming.
- the conventional medical aspirator has a skin closure method of knotting the skin of the patient and the tube of the medical aspirator with a thread as described above, such a skin closure method is impossible to completely fix, according to the surgical site of the patient Frequently, the tube is separated by movement or carelessness, and the surface management is difficult because the gauze or the tape is adhered to the treatment site after the medical aspirator.

- medical aspirator fixing device 100 according to an embodiment of the present invention is large tube member support 110 and the tube member support 110 It comprises an attachment means (gauze and stickers) for attaching to the patient.
- the tube member is embedded in the body for infusion, bodily fluid circulation, or discharge of fluid, and in addition to the medical aspirator, the tube includes a catheter, a bronchial tube, a central venous catheter, and a suction catheter. .
- the tube member is used to inject or discharge the chemical solution into the body in the form of a hollow cylinder.
- the tube member support 110 is for firmly supporting the tube member 140. That is, the tube member 140 of the medical aspirator, including a gastric tube catheter, bronchial tube, central field venous catheter and suction catheter Prevents flow or rotation in the horizontal or vertical direction relative to the site of the procedure.
- the tube member support 110 includes a body 112 and a cover member 114.
- the main body 112 is disposed on the adhesive pad of the attachment means through the bottom surface, that is, the upper surface of the gauze 120, the gauze 120 is attached to the skin of the patient by a medical adhesive (not shown) provided on the bottom surface. .
- a hydrocoloid adhesive may be used to attach the gauze 120 to the skin of the patient.
- the bottom adhesive layer of the gauze 120 is covered with a sticker 130, that is, a release liner (release liner), remove the sticker 130 in use, and then attach the gauze 120 to the patient's skin, the gauze 120 And the sticker 130 is formed so that the through-holes 122 and 132 for the tube member 140 connected to the treatment site is withdrawn, respectively.
- a sticker 130 that is, a release liner (release liner)
- the main body 112 has a rectangular shape having a predetermined thickness and has a circular opening 112a communicating with the through holes 122 and 132 at a central portion thereof, and a cover member 114 is hinged at an upper end of one side of the opening. Is connected.
- the cover member 114 is connected to the main body 112 through the hinge pin 114a, so that the cover member 114 can close or open the opening 112a through vertical rotation.
- a grip portion 114b for holding, pulling or pushing by hand on one side of the outer circumference of the cover member 114 is formed to protrude integrally.
- a tube storing hole 112b is formed at one side of the main body 112 in a direction orthogonal to the cover member 114, and the tube member is disposed along the longitudinal direction of the inner circumferential surface of the tube storing hole.
- a plurality of locking protrusions 112c having a 'V' cross section for preventing slippage of the 140 are formed at equal intervals.
- the material of the support 110 a mixture of polyethylene (PE) and elastomer (Elastomer), which is moderately hard, flexible and harmless to the human body, is used, but is not necessarily limited thereto.
- PE polyethylene
- Elastomer elastomer
- Chloride, acrylonitrile butadiene styrene, plastics such as polyester, polymers or composites can be used.
- the support 110 is preferably to have a transparent material.
- the tube member 140 is inserted into the affected part of the surgical patient and secretions such as blood or bodily fluid accumulated in the affected part through the tube member 140 (10 in FIG. 1). In the process of collecting and storing in) it is necessary to ensure that the tube member 140 does not fall out of the affected part.
- a hospital official such as a nurse uses a medical aspirator fixing device 100 to fix the patient at an appropriate position (the affected part), and removes the sticker 130 from the gauze 120 and then attaches the skin to the patient's gauze ( 120 is attached to the skin of a patient by a medical adhesive (eg, hydrocolloid adhesive) provided on the bottom.
- a medical adhesive eg, hydrocolloid adhesive
- the tube member 140 is drawn out of the main body 112 through the opening 112a and the tube storage hole 112b of the main body 112 via the through holes 122 and 132, and in this state
- the cover member 114 covers the opening 112a by holding the branch 114b and rotating the cover member 114 downward.
- the tube member support 110 is made of a transparent material, the hospital staff, the patient, the guardian, etc. can easily check the operation state of the operation site or the tube member 140.
- the tube member support 110 which is a main component constituting the medical aspirator, is firmly attached to the skin of the patient by the gauze 120 of the tube member support 110, and the tube member 140 is a tube.
- Secretions such as blood or body fluid accumulated in the affected part may be drawn out in a state of being supported so as not to slip by the locking protrusion 112c provided along the longitudinal direction of the inner circumferential surface of the accommodation hole 112b.
- the skin sealing method of knotting the patient's skin and the tube member 140 of the medical aspirator with thread is not necessary, and the tube member 140 is firmly attached to the patient's skin by the tube member support 110. It is possible to reduce the incidence of secondary infection due to the pulling out regardless of will, and prevent the tube member 140 or medical aspirator from being separated from the surgical site by the patient's movement or carelessness depending on the surgical site. do.
- the gauze 120 and the tape 130 is attached to the lower tube member 140, the inconvenience of adhering a separate gauze or tape to the treatment site after the medical aspirator procedure is eliminated.
- the tube member support 110 is made of a transparent material, it is easy to check the fixing state of the skin and the tube member 140 by observing it early even if the tube member 140 is slightly removed due to the internal pressure of the body.
